2012-04-02 9 views
0

Ich habe eine kurze Frage. Ich benutze jQuery-Mobile für die mobile Webentwicklung. Ich weiß, wie man eine feste Position für Kopf- und Fußzeile festlegt, aber eine einfache Frage: Ist es möglich, die Fußzeilennavigation des Browsers zu verbergen? Ich meine, in Safari mit Safari-Browser haben wir Safari in Fußzeile, die nach vorne, hinten, Lesezeichen usw. Optionen an der Unterseite verfügt. Ich habe meine eigene Fußzeile für Tippoptionen und möchte diese verwenden und die integrierten Tippoptionen der Safari ausblenden. Ist es möglich?Ist es möglich, die Fußzeilen-Navigationsoption des Safari-Browsers mit jQuery-Mobile vollständig zu verbergen?

Dank

Antwort

5

Wenn ein Benutzer dann Ihre Website in ihre Heimat-Bildschirm hinzufügt, wenn sie auf das Symbol klicken, um Ihre Website zu betrachten Sie eine Vollbild-UI erzwingen.

Hier ist eine Liste der unterstützten Meta-Tags ist, dass Sie zu Ihrer Website hinzufügen können, die verwendet werden, wenn der Benutzer fügt Ihrer Website in ihre Heimat-Bildschirm: http://developer.apple.com/library/safari/#documentation/appleapplications/reference/SafariHTMLRef/Articles/MetaTags.html

apple-mobile-web-app-fähige

<meta name="apple-mobile-web-app-capable" content="yes"> 

Wenn Inhalte auf yes gesetzt ist, läuft die Web-Anwendung im Vollbild-Modus ; Sonst nicht. Das Standardverhalten besteht darin, Safari zu Webinhalte anzuzeigen. Sie können bestimmen, ob eine Webseite im Vollbildmodus angezeigt wird, indem Sie window.navigator.standalone read-only verwenden Boolean JavaScript-Eigenschaft.

Verfügbar in iOS 2.1 und höher.

+0

Hallo Jasper, vielen Dank für die schnelle Lösung. – jeewan